The e-Logistics and Taxation Working Committee deals with different topics related to the parcel delivery market, both at global and EU level. In particular, the Working Committee’s activities are split in two parts: the e-Logistics part focuses on all EU and Universal Postal Union (UPU) issues that are relevant for e-commerce and that have an impact on postal/parcel delivery services, standardisation and other topics; the Taxation part deals with direct and indirect taxation with regards to e-commerce.
